How much do weekend rn j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for weekend rn in Rialto, CA is $44.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34.95 and $50.84 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Does a Weekend RN Do?

As a weekend RN, you take shifts on the weekend when other nurses are unavailable, allowing hospitals and other care facilities to provide continuity of care and remain open 24/7. This is usually a part-time position, with most weekend RN's working two 8-12 hour shifts Saturday-Sunday each week. Some facilities also count Friday as a weekend day and offer a three-shift schedule instead. In this role, you may make patient visits, answer telephone calls to provide remote healthcare and address any medical emergencies that occur during your shift as a weekend nurse. As an RN, weekend work usually focuses on hospitals and hospice facilities, but you may find positions that involve traveling to visit patients outside of a clinical setting.

What are some unique challenges and rewards of working as a Weekend RN compared to a standard weekday nursing position?

Weekend RNs often face a distinct set of challenges, including managing higher patient-to-nurse ratios and handling more acute or urgent cases, as there may be fewer staff and support services available on weekends. However, this role also offers unique rewards, such as greater autonomy, opportunities to hone critical thinking and decision-making skills, and often a more flexible schedule or additional compensation. Weekend RNs typically collaborate closely with a dedicated core team, fostering strong teamwork and communication. This experience can be valuable for career advancement, as it demonstrates adaptability and strong clinical competence in a fast-paced environment.

What is a Weekend RN?

A Weekend RN is a registered nurse who primarily works during the weekends, often covering shifts on Saturdays and Sundays. These nurses provide patient care, administer medications, monitor patient progress, and collaborate with doctors and other healthcare staff. Weekend RNs may work in hospitals, nursing homes, or other healthcare facilities, and their schedules are designed to ensure continuous high-quality care throughout the week. Weekend shifts can sometimes offer higher pay rates or shift differentials due to the non-traditional hours.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Weekend RN,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Weekend RN, you need current RN licensure, strong clinical assessment skills, and experience in acute or long-term care settings.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) systems and up-to-date certifications such as BLS or ACLS are often required. Excellent time management, adaptability, and communication skills are essential for managing patient care during typically higher-acuity weekend shifts. These competencies ensure patient safety, efficient care delivery, and effective teamwork when staffing levels and resources may be limited.

Hospice RN / Registered Nurse Duties Include:
• Performs the initial assessment and periodic re-evaluation of nursing needs of the patient/family. Where indicated, performs special pain assessment and spiritual assessment.
• Observes, evaluates, reports to the physician and the Hospice Interdisciplinary Team significant changes in the patient's/family's physical and psychosocial condition. Discusses client problems with supervisor. Assists with development updates in patient's plan of care within two days of admission or condition change.
• Attends and documents conferences with therapists and volunteers as needed for coordinated care.
• Documentation reflects understanding of agency policy and procedures. Demonstrate ability to complete client care plan. Provides clinical supervision. Cost effectively manages patient's Hospice benefit within Hospice guidelines.
